R.E.4 Propeller

R.E. 4 Mazco Propeller

The Mazco R.E.4 (4 Blade) was developed for boaters looking for maximum low end and mid-range without sacrificing top end. This propeller was the result of endless hours of testing and modifications to yield a new performance propeller. The R.E.4 is a propeller that can be run at extremely high transom heights and still maintain “bite” because of its larger diameter. This propeller provides excellent bow lift and carries the entire boat.

The Mazco R.E.4 is a 1 piece casting of 15-5 P.H. stainless steel, the most desirable stainless for tensile strength. The hub I.D. and mating surfaces are bored and machined for exact tolerances. The R.E.4 is fully heat treated, solution annealed, and age hardened to 31-33 Rockwell for uniform strength.

The R.E.4 is blueprinted for exact standards. It is formulated with progressive pitch and parabolic rake to give maximum performance. The blades are thinned for ultimate speed, but yet thick enough for durability and are able to withstand the torque of the highest horsepower outboards. The propeller is then balanced to precise standards and is polished to a mirror finish to reduce drag. Each of our blueprinted R.E.4 propellers is assigned an identification number. The number is stamped on the propeller and added to our permanent records. These propellers are available in right hand rotation only with 22″, 24″, 26″, 28″, 30″ and 32″ pitches.
